Why These Connect
The narrative assertion
"The Doctor's discovery of a sniper rifle in the Panopticon gallery in Episode 9 is directly echoed in Episode 10 when he reconstructs the assassination trajectory using forensic evidence."

Why This Matters Across Episodes
The longer arc this connection carries
This shows the narrative throughline of assassination threats in the Panopticon spaces. What the Doctor glimpses in his vision and then sees physically becomes the basis for his scientific reconstruction of the crime in Episode 10.
